Устройство для программного управления четырехфазным шаговым двигателем

Иллюстрации

Показать все

Реферат

 

Изобретение относится к автоматике и вычислительной технике и может быть использовано для управления станками , оснащенными шаговыми двигателями с ненасыщенными магнитными системами . Целью изобретения является упрощение схемы и уменьшение потребляемой энергии. Устройство содержит четыре мультиплексора 4 на 1 1.171.4, фазные обмотки 2.1-2.4 шагового двигателя , мультиплексоры Зп на 1, 3.1, 3.2, реверсивный двоичный счетчик 4, группу элементов И, дешифратор 6, нереверсивный счетчик 7. 6 ил.

СОЮЗ СОВЕТСКИХ

Ш ВВ

РЕСПУБЛИК ае 09 рц G .05 В 19/40

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ИЯМ

AH ГКНТ СССР

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

1 (21) 4696033/24 (22) 24,05.89 (46) 15.05,91. Бюп. 9 18 (72) В,Ш. Арутюнян, А.З. Мурадян и Г,Б. Мнацаканян (53) 621.503,55(088,8) (56) Авторское свидетельство СССР

В 1020800, кл. С 05 В 19!40, 1982, Авторское свидетельство СССР

У 1531072, кл. С 05 В 19/40, 1988. (54) УСТРОЙСТВО ДПЯ ПРОГРАММНОГО УПРАВЛКНИЯ ЧКТЫРКХФАЗНЫМ ШАГОВЫМ ДВИГАTEJIEM

2 (57) Изобретение относится к автоматике и вычислительной технике и может быть использовано для управления станками, оснащенными шаговыми двигателями с ненасыщенными магнитными системами. Целью изобретения является упрощение схемы и уменьшение потребляемой энергии. Устройство содержит четыре мультиплексора "4 на 1" 1 ° 1-.1.4, фазные обмотки 2.1-2.4 шагового двигателя, мультиплексоры "Зп на 1", 3.1, 3.2, реверсивный двоичный счетчик 4, группу элементов И, дешифратор 6, нереверсивный счетчик 7. 6 ил.

1649513

Изооретение относится к автоматике и вычислительной технике и может быть использовано для управления станками, оснащенными шаговыми двигателями с насыщенными магнитными системами, Цель изобретения — упрощение устройства и уменьшение потребляемой энергии.

На фиг. 1 представлена функциональная схема предлагаемого устройства для общего случая, когда коэффициент дробления шага равен К =3n, где п = — 2,4,6,,, — четное число; на

<риг, 2 — то же, когда n = 1,3,5. нечетное число; на фиг. 3 и 4 — то же, для конкретных случаев выполнения схем, когда соответственно К =

6 (п=2) И К =9(п=З); на фиг . 5 и 6 временные диаграммы формируемых фазных токов и номограммы результирующих моментов для случаев соответственно

К =6 (п=2) и К =9 (n=3) .

Предлагаемое устройство содержит с первого 1.1 по четвертый 1.4 муль- 25 типлексоры "4 на 1", выходы которых подключены соответственно (непосредственно или через ключевые усилители мощности) к фазным обмоткам 2.1-2.4 шагового двигателя, первый 3.1 и вто- 3О. рой 3,2 мультиплексоры "Зг, на 1", реверсивный двоичный счетчик 4, группа лементов И 5.1-5.(4п-3) при четных и и И 5.1-5.(4n-2) при нечетных и, дешифратор 6 и двоичный счетчик 7.

В оощем случае число элементов И при четном п равно 4п-3 а при нечетном — 4n-2, Число выходов дешифратора 6 пыоирается равным 4п. Коэффициент пересчета счетчика 7 Равен 4п, 40 а число его выходных разрядов (и число входов управления дешифратора 6) определяется выражением ) log4 t .

Коэвфициент пересчета младших разрядов счетчика 4 равен Зп, число этих разрядов определяется выражением

)1ag " f, Число информационных входов каждого из мультиплексоров 3,1 и 3.2 также равно 3п, а число их адресных входов определяется выражением 50

)log " (, Коэффициент дробления шага выражается рормулой K=3n, где п=1

2g3y o ° а c

11редлагаемое устройство работает следующим образом, Высокочастотная тактовая последовательность непрерывно поступает на нхад нереверсивного двоичного счетчика 7. В результате этого на выходах деши@ратора 6 периодически формируются кодовые комбинации с одним нулем и

4п-1 единицами, а на выходах элементов И 5 — прямоугольные высокочастотные сигналы со скважностью

4п-3. .. 3, 2 ча чп мп

4п-2 4п-3, и со скиажиостаю

4п 4п ных и

2, 1 при нечетных и.

4п 4п

° ° ° а

Эти сигналы, а также сигналы с первого выхода дешифратора 6 со скважностью при нечетных и через выход мультиплексора 3,1 поступает к первому входу мультиплексора 1.3 и далее через его выход к третьей фазе 2.3 шагового двигателя. В результате интегрирования высокочастотных сигналов в индуктивности через третью фазу 2.3 двигателя протекает ток величиной

2 Хн при четных и и и - при нечетных п где I — н

4п

9 номинальный (максимальный) TQK в фазе, Одновременно с этим единичный логический потенциал через первый информационный вход и выход мультиплексора 3.2 поступает к первому информационному входу мультиплексора 1.2, Далее этот потенциал через выход мультиплексора

1,2 прикладывается к < второй фазе 2,2 двигателя, что приводит к установлению в ней тока номинальной величины I .

При этом через первые входы и выходы мультиплексоров 1.1 и 1.4 к фазам 2.1 и 2.4 прикладываются нулевые потенциалы, в результате чего токи в них от4п-1 — поступают к соответствующим ин4п формационным входам мультиплексоров

3.1 и 3,2.

Исходным является состояние, при котором реверсивный двоичный счетчик

4 находится в нулевом состоянии. На все управляющие входы мультиплексоров

3.1, 3,2 и 1.1-1.4 со всех выходов старших и младших разрядов реверсивного счетчика 4 поступают нулевые потенциалы и выбираются их первые инфор- мационные входы. Присутствующий на первом информационном входе мультиплексора 3.1 высокочастотный сигнал со

2 1 скважностью - при четных и и йп 4п .

164951 сутствуют. Этому исходному состоянию соответствует точка О на фиг, 56 и

66, С поступлением первых Зп-1 .низкочастотных тактирующих импульсов в счетчике 4 поочередно записываются, цифры 1,2,...,3n-1. В результате этого поочередно выбираются с вторых по

Зп-е информационные входы мультиплексоров 3.1 и 3.2 и коммутируются соответствующие потенциалы и liMM-сигналы.

При этом в мультипдексорах 1.1-1.4 остаются выбранными первые информационные входы. Благодаря этому к фазам 2.2 и 2.3 двигателя поочередно поступают последующие lllHM-сигналы, приводящие к протеканию через них соответствующих токов. Этим состояниям соответствуют точки 1-Зn-1 на фиг.56 20 и 66..

Последующий Зп-й низкочастотный тактирующий импульс устанавливает в нулевые состояния младшие разряды счетчика 4 и формирует импульс перено-25 са для записи в старших разрядах этого счетчика единицы. Благодаря этому выбираются вторые информационные входы мультиплексоров 1.1-1,4 и первые информационные входы мультиплексоров Зп

3.1 и 3,2. При этом фазы 2.1 и 2.2 находятся в обесточенном состоянии, через фазу 2,3 протекает номинальный ток I а через фазу 2.4 — ток

6 устанавливается в нулевое исходное состояние, Для обеспечения обратного направления вращения двигателя (реверсирования) меняется на обратный логический потенциал на входе "Рев," счетчика 4.

Частота импульсов,,подаваемых на шину Е, выбирается исходя из величины электромагнитной постоянной времени данного двигателя так; чтобы при интегрировании индуктивностью обмоток высокочастотных liIHM-сигналов пульсация тока не превышала допустимого значения. А частота импульсов К„ выбирается в соответствии с требуемой скоростью вращения ротора двигателя.

Как видно из фиг. 56 и бб,-распределение вектора электромагнитного момента по полю достаточно близко к круговому, что позволяет при управлении двигателем с ненасыщенной магнитной системой обеспечить равномерность отработки дробных шагов.

Из фиг. 5а и ба видно, что в каждом такте функционирования устройства под током находятся всего две фазы двигателя, что позволяет значительно экономить потребяемую мощность от источника питания двигателя.

Формула из о бр ет ения — - при четных и и, " при нечетных

2Х н чп 4п и. Этому положению двигателя соответствуют точки Зп на фиг. 56 и 66.

Этим завершается первая четверть цикла управления четырехфазным шаговым двигателем, в результате чего ротор отрабатывает К=Зп дрооных шагов величиной

Кос

ЯР 3 где 0(Q0 — основной (конструктивный) шаг двигателя, Три последующие четверть-циклы работы устройства аналогичны первому четверть-циклу. Отличия заключаются только в том, что по старшим разрядам счетчика 4 поочередно выбираются последующие информационные входы мультиплексоров 1.1-1.4.

После завершения полного цикла функционирования устройства счетчик 4 полностью обнуляется и вся система

Устройство дця программного управления четырехфазным шаговым двигателем, содержащее первый, второй, третий и четвертый мультиплексоры "4 на

1", выходы которых подключены к со,уп ответствующим фазным обмоткам шагового двигателя, реверсивный двоичный счетчик импульсов, выходы двух старших разрядов которого подключены соответственно к управляющим входам муль45 типлексоров "4 на 1", а входы тактиро вания и реверса соответственно являются входами низкочастотных импульсов

1 1 тактирования и реверса устройства,первый и второй мультиплексоры "Çn на

50 где n = 1,2 3,..., — .управляющие входы которых соединены соответственно. с выходами мпадших разрядов реверсив- "

Ъ ного двоичного счетчика импульсов, двоичный счетчик импульсов, тактовый вход которого является входом высокочастотных. импульсов тактирования устройства, дешифратор, входы которого подключены соответственно к выходам двоичного счетчика импульсов, группу

1649513 элементов И, первый вход первого из которых соединен с первым выходом дешифратора, первый вход каядого последующего элемента И соединен с выхо5 дом предыдущего элемента И,вторые входы с первого по последний элементов И соединены соответственно с выходами дешифратора, начиная со второго, о т л и ч а ю щ е е с я тем, что, 10 с целью упрощения устройства и умень- шения потребляемой энергии, первый выI ход дешифратора при четном и соеди5п-2 . нен с (†)-м информационным входом

2 ;,15 первого мультиплексора "Çn на 1" и с

n+2 (- -)-м информационным входом второго ( мультиплексора "Çn на 1", а при нечет5п-1 10 ном и соединен с ()-м информационным входом первого мультиплексора

1 °

Зп Hcl 1 и с (— -) «м информационным

Н

n+3

2 входом второго мультиплексора "Çn на выходы первого, второго,...,(п-2)-ro, (n-1)-ro элементов И.при чет30 ном и соединены соответственно с

5п-4 . 5n-6 Çn+2 ()м()м(— — «)м

2 2 " 2

Ф

3n . (— )-м информационными входами перво- 35

ro мультиплексора "Зп на. 1" и с и+4 n+6 3п-2 (— — )-м (— -)-м

2 2 2 ()-м

3п (— ) -м информационными входами вто2 рого мультиплексора "Зп на.1", а при нечетном и соединены соответственно

5п-3 5п-5 Зп+Э () М, (†) М, ° ° °,() 3n+1 ()-м информационными входами пер 50

2 вого мультиплексора "Çn на 1" и с (+ ) (n+7) (Зп-1 Зп+1 информационными входами второго муль- 55

I типлексора "Çn на 1", выходы (п+1)-ro, (n+2) -г о,..., (4n-5) -го, (4n-3) -ro элементов И при четном и соединены со3п-2 Зп-4 ответственно c (2 ) м ()-м,..., вторым, первым информационными входами первого .,мультиплексора "Çn на 1"

Зй+2 Çn+4 и с ()-м,(†-у-)-м,...,(3n-2)-м, (3n-1)-м информационными входами второго мультиплексора "Çn на 1", а выходы (n+f)™го, (n+2)-ro,...,(4n-4)-го, (4n-2)-го элементов И при нечетном п соединены соответственно . с с

Зп-1 Çn-1, (2 ) M (2 ) Mii ° ° ° вторым пер

" вым информационными входами первого мультиплексора "Çn на 1" и с () Mó () му ° ° ° у (Зп 1) му Зпм

Зп+3 Зп+5 информационньии входами второго мультиплексора "Зп на 1", при четном и с

5п (†)-го по Çn-й информационные вхо2 ды первого мультиплексора "Çn на 1" и с первого по (n/2)-й информационные входы второго мультиплексора "Çn на 1", 5n+1 а при нечетном п с (— у-)-rî по Зп-й инвормационные входы первого мультиплексора "Çn на 1" и с первого по и+1 (†)-й информационные входы второго мультиплексора "Çn на 1" соединены с шиной единичного логического уровня, Зп-й информационный вход второго мультиплексора "Çn на 1" при четном п соединен с шиной нулевого логического уровня, выход первого мультиплексора

"Зп на 1" соединен с третьим, четвертым, первым и вторым информационными входами соответственно первого, второго, третьего, четвертого мультиплексоров "4 на 1", выход второго мультиплексора "Зп на 1" соединен с четвертым, первым, вторым, третьим информационными входами соответственно первого, второго, третьего, четвертого мультиплексоров "4 на 1", остальные информационные входы которых соединены с шиной нулевого логического уровня.

1649513

1649513!

6495!3

1649513

1649513

Составитель И, Слинько

Техред Л.Сердюкова Корректор Н. Ревска„

Редактор JI. Пчолинская

Заказ 1521 Тираж 488 Подписное

ВБИ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035, Москва, Ж-35, Рауюская наб., д. 4/5

Производственно-издательский комбинат "Патент", г, Ужгород, ул. Гагарина, 10 1